I'm running on stable (15.0 64bit)

Thanks for looking at this Chris. I have managed to get VTK to build now. My solution was to uninstall the existing (older) version of VTK before creating the newer package. If someone wants to confirm this as a repeatable solution then it may be worth adding a comment to that effect to the readme.

I use current as default OS, so some days ago I first posted the question in the Ponce's thread in LQ about the same error, that occurred enabling all optional features (IMAGING, MPI, VIEWS, ecc.). I temporary "solved" disabling MPI. This happened always trying to build the new version with previous VTK 9.0.3 installed

Following the suggestion given by Chris, today I rebuilt VTK with all features enabled after uninstalling the previous version and I confirm that the build ends successfully. At this point it appears obvious that extended settings require the removal of previous installation.
